RESOLUTION NO.1




   1.Demanding centralisation of PLI and RPLI works and urging for no decentralisation of PLI and RPLI works:

This Central Working Committee meeting of the All India Postal Administrative Offices Employees Union (Group-‘C’ & ‘D’) affiliated to NFPE held on and from 23-09-13 to 24-10-13 at Ranchi notes with grave concern that various works of CO/RO relating to PLI & RPLI are being decentralised to the Division/Units time and again. This meeting also expresses utter dissatisfaction regarding the unilateral attitude of the Department for the following points.
Vast experiences of the staff of Circle Offices relating to PLI & RPLI works are not being taken into account before issuance of the orders in respect of decentralisation.
Before decentralisation of works in connection with the acceptance of proposal and settlement of claims, proper infrastructure and training arrangement have not been provided to the Division/Units and as a result, delay is taking place for after-sales services which is causing a lot harassment to the insurants.
The staff strength of the Circle Offices/Regional Offices are being adversely affected.

Therefore, this CWC meeting urges upon the authority to restrain from issuing such unilateral orders which is causing adverse effect to the staff strength of Circle Offices, Regional Offices and DPLI Office and demands immediate discussion regarding the said PLI/RPLI matters with the NFPE and Administrative Union (CHQ).

This CWC meeting further resolves that the copy of the Resolution would be sent to DG (Posts), Dak Bhawan, New Delhi.

RESOLUTION NO.2





2. Alarming situation regarding the staff strength of circle and regional offices:

This CWC meeting notes with serious concern that inspite of repeated persuasions, a large number of vacancies in PACO cadre are remaining unfilled due to non framing of new recruitment rules for the PACO cadre causing untold sufferings and constraints for the functioning of Circle Administrative offices including regions. In this regard this CWC feels that in all other wings i.e. PA/SA/PASBCO examination have long been taken even results have been declared whereas we are still suffering.
Therefore, this CWC meeting urges upon the authority to initiate immediate action for filling up of the vacancies in the PACO cadre on priority basis to mitigate the sufferings of the people working in Circle Administrative offices.  

This CWC meeting further resolves that the copy of the Resolution would be sent to DG (Posts), Dak Bhawan, New Delhi.

RESOLUTION NO.3




3. Against curtailment of staff strength of the century old office of the Director Postal Life Insurance , Kolkata :

This CWC meeting note with a serious concern that in the name of all out modernisation of the PLI/RPLI works, a continuous process for effecting huge curtailment of staff strength in the century old Director, PLI, Kolkata office is going on, which has been very much detrimental to the interest of the staff of the said office.

Therefore, this CWC meeting urges upon the authority to restrain from issuing such unilateral orders which is causing adverse effect to the staff strength of Circle Offices, Regional Offices and DPLI Office and demands immediate discussion regarding the said PLI/RPLI matters with the NFPE and Administrative Union (CHQ).

GDS PARLIAMENT MARCH ON 11.12.2013

All India Postal Employees Union – GDS (NFPE) and affiliate of Confederation will be organizing a massive Parliament March of Gramin Dak Sevaks on 11th December 2013 demanding inclusion of GDS under the purview of 7th CPC, Regularisation, Civil Servant Status, and other benefits at par with Departmental employees. All affiliates of the Confederation are also requested to ensure maximum support and cooperation for making the GDS Parliament March a grand success.
